WebJul 22, 2016 · 3. Food Poisoning. Food poisoning can lead to green poop because food passes through your digestive tract too quickly for the bile pigment to be purged. WebE. Coli is a very common cause of food-borne diarrhea. It is carried by foods contaminated by feces and symptoms including diarrhea (sometimes bloody) begin 3-4 days after the food is consumed.
